The State Civil Service Commission will hold a public hearing on Wednesday, December 7, 2005 to consider proposed changes to the Classification and Pay Plan.

 

The hearing will begin at 9:00 a.m. and will be held in the auditorium of the Claiborne Building, 1201 Third Street, Baton Rouge, Louisiana.

EXHIBIT A: Labor/Trades (WS) Implementation Order and Grid

Implementation Order for the Labor/Trades (WS) Schedule and Grid Proposed at the December 7, 2005 Pay Hearing

The purpose of this order is to effect the transition of employees from the current Labor/Trades pay grid to the proposed Labor/Trades pay grid.

  1. All current base supplement pay that falls within the employee’s new range shall be converted into base pay.
  2. If the employee’s individual pay rate falls within the range of the new grade, his pay shall not change.
  3. If the employee’s individual pay rate falls above the new range maximum, his pay shall be red-circled until the range encompasses the rate.
  4. If the employee’s individual pay rate falls below the minimum of the new range, his pay rate shall be brought up to the new minimum.
  5. Other Special Pay not associated with either payment for location, education/credentials, and/or other forms of variable pay may be converted into base pay upon approval by the Civil Service Commission. Requests for conversion of Special Pay to base pay must be submitted to the Civil Service Commission for approval.
